Community health workers at the dawn of a new era: 6. Recruitment, training, and continuing education.

BACKGROUND
This is the sixth of our 11-paper supplement entitled "Community Health Workers at the Dawn of New Era". Expectations of community health workers (CHWs) have expanded in recent years to encompass a wider array of services to numerous subpopulations, engage communities to collaborate with and to assist health systems in responding to complex and sometimes intensive threats. In this paper, we explore a set of key considerations for training of CHWs in response to their enhanced and changing roles and provide actionable recommendations based on current evidence and case examples for health systems leaders and other stakeholders to utilize.
METHODS
We carried out a focused review of relevant literature. This review included particular attention to a 2014 book chapter on training of CHWs for large-scale programmes, a systematic review of reviews about CHWs, the 2018 WHO guideline for CHWs, and a 2020 compendium of 29 national CHW programmes. We summarized the findings of this latter work as they pertain to training. We incorporated the approach to training used by two exemplary national CHW programmes: for health extension workers in Ethiopia and shasthya shebikas in Bangladesh. Finally, we incorporated the extensive personal experiences of all the authors regarding issues in the training of CHWs.
RESULTS
The paper explores three key themes: (1) professionalism, (2) quality and performance, and (3) scaling up. Professionalism: CHW tasks are expanding. As more CHWs become professionalized and highly skilled, there will still be a need for neighbourhood-level voluntary CHWs with a limited scope of work. Quality and performance: Training approaches covering relevant content and engaging CHWs with other related cadres are key to setting CHWs up to be well prepared. Strategies that have been recently integrated into training include technological tools and provision of additional knowledge; other strategies emphasize the ongoing value of long-standing approaches such as regular home visitation. Scale-up: Scaling up entails reaching more people and/or adding more complexity and quality to a programme serving a defined population. When CHW programmes expand, many aspects of health systems and the roles of other cadres of workers will need to adapt, due to task shifting and task sharing by CHWs.
CONCLUSION
Going forward, if CHW programmes are to reach their full potential, ongoing, up-to-date, professionalized training for CHWs that is integrated with training of other cadres and that is responsive to continued changes and emerging needs will be essential. Professionalized training will require ongoing monitoring and evaluation of the quality of training, continual updating of pre-service training, and ongoing in-service training-not only for the CHWs themselves but also for those with whom CHWs work, including communities, CHW supervisors, and other cadres of health professionals. Strong leadership, adequate funding, and attention to the needs of each cadre of CHWs can make this possible.
背景
这是我们题为“新时代的社区卫生工作者”的 11 篇增刊中的第六篇。近年来,人们对社区卫生工作者(CHW)的期望不断扩大,期望他们能够提供更广泛的服务,涵盖更多的服务人群,并与社区合作,协助卫生系统应对复杂且有时较为紧急的威胁。在本文中,我们探讨了一系列针对 CHW 培训的关键考虑因素,以应对他们不断增强和变化的角色,并根据当前证据和案例为卫生系统领导者和其他利益相关者提供可操作的建议。
方法
我们对相关文献进行了重点回顾。这项综述特别关注了 2014 年关于大规模项目中 CHW 培训的一章、关于 CHW 的系统评价综述、2018 年世卫组织 CHW 指南以及 2020 年 29 个国家 CHW 方案的综合报告。我们总结了后一项工作中与培训相关的发现。我们还纳入了两个具有代表性的国家 CHW 方案的培训方法:埃塞俄比亚的卫生推广工作者和孟加拉国的 shasthya shebikas。最后,我们纳入了所有作者在 CHW 培训方面的丰富经验。
结果
本文探讨了三个关键主题:(1)专业化,(2)质量和绩效,(3)扩大规模。专业化:CHW 的任务正在扩大。随着越来越多的 CHW 变得专业化和高度熟练,仍然需要有工作范围有限的社区一级志愿 CHW。质量和绩效:涵盖相关内容并让 CHW 与其他相关干部互动的培训方法是让 CHW 做好充分准备的关键。最近纳入培训的策略包括技术工具和提供额外知识;其他策略则强调了长期以来的方法的持续价值,如定期家访。扩大规模:扩大规模意味着为一个特定人群服务的方案要覆盖更多的人,或者增加更多的复杂性和质量。当 CHW 方案扩大时,由于 CHW 的任务转移和任务分担,卫生系统的许多方面以及其他干部的角色将需要适应。
结论
如果 CHW 方案要充分发挥潜力,那么对 CHW 进行持续的、最新的、专业化的培训至关重要,这种培训应与其他干部的培训相结合,并对持续变化和新出现的需求做出反应。专业化培训将需要对培训质量进行持续监测和评估,不断更新职前培训,并对 CHW 本身以及与 CHW 合作的人员进行持续的在职培训,包括社区、CHW 主管和其他卫生专业人员。强有力的领导力、充足的资金以及对每个 CHW 干部的需求的关注可以使这一切成为可能。
